Title :
Coaxial probe modeling in waveguides and cavities

Abstract :
Extraction of the two-port scattering matrix of a probe-excited semiinfinite waveguide based on moment method solutions of three short-circuited guides is presented. Results show that this solution (1) provides an easy way to determine the two-port scattering matrix of probe-excited waveguide problems, and (2) enables the accurate determination of the loading effects of the probe on the resonant frequencies of unperturbed cavities. Both of these provide a key to the design of input/output cavities of waveguide filters. Agreement with experimental data is excellent for loose-coupled probe-excited semiinfinite waveguide problems.<>
